Expectations have doubled for the Creighton Skating School as far as registration goes, which is leaving coach Sheri Parr Campbell pleased. For this first year, Parr Campbell says she, along with coach Ray Donaldson, would have been happy with 40 or 60 kids. "We've got about 90 kids registered and there are still more interested," she says. And she adds, "it was a pleasant surprise." Parr Campbell attributes the larger than expected number of hopeful skaters to "lots of new ones (kids) this year." Both the Can Skate and Pre-power programs are "huge," says Parr Campbell. Before becoming a coach, she took the Can Skate program with the Flin Flin Skating Club. The Creighton Skating School starts October 9 and will run until mid-March. For those who missed the first registration date, a second one will be taking place at the Sportex on September 14 and 15.
